Procter & Gamble (P&G) is a multinational consumer goods corporation that has a significant presence across the globe. The company, which was founded in 1837, has grown to become one of the largest companies in the world, with a diverse range of products and services. 3. Question: Where is Procter & Gamble's headquarters located?
Answer: Procter & Gamble's headquarters are located in Cincinnati, Ohio, United States.
